Choose the correct verb to complete the sentence: ‘Each one of us ____ a pen.’

A. has
B. have
C. are
D. were
Correct answer is: A. has
'Each one' is singular, requiring the singular verb 'has.'

Complete the sentence with the correct auxiliary verb: ‘John loves flying, but we ____.’

A. doesn't
B. aren't
C. hasn't
D. don't
Correct answer is: D. don't
The plural subject 'we' requires 'don't' to match the verb 'love.'

Who was the founder of Microsoft?

A. Steve Jobs
B. Larry Page and Sergey Brin
C. Bill Gates and Paul Allen
D. Mark Zuckerberg
Correct answer is: C. Bill Gates and Paul Allen
Bill Gates and Paul Allen co-founded Microsoft in 1975.

The military tank was first developed by:

A. Britain
B. Germany
C. US
D. Russia
Correct answer is: A. Britain
The first military tank, the Mark I, was developed by Britain during World War I in 1916.

Who invented the printing press?

A. Isaac Newton
B. Johannes Gutenberg
C. Leonardo da Vinci
D. Thomas Edison
Correct answer is: B. Johannes Gutenberg
Johannes Gutenberg invented the movable-type printing press in the 15th century, revolutionizing publishing.
